As if providing speech therapy to preschoolers was not difficult enough, this school year presented challenges that seemed so daunting and unattainable that I spent the first few weeks of plan time with my head just spinning and holding back tears. Through the funds that you provided I was able to purchase pre-made themed language virtual classroom ideas, then tweak them to add on more speech and language focused books, songs, and activities that your funds also provided. It has made this new role in my job a much easier transition, saving me hours and hours of time trying to find and create these virtual speech therapy materials on my own. I was able to take these materials, focus, create weekly themed classroom assignments and move onto the actual therapy with confidence. I have been able to post one each week for the families to use as they have time, and then use the materials in my weekly sessions to reinforce the vocabulary, concepts, and continue to grow the child's skills in multiple contexts. The themes I have created so far have also had a literacy foundation, because this area can be further impacted with a speech and language delay. The student's have enjoyed Little Red Riding Hood week, The 3 Bears, The Mitten, Pete the Cat, and many more. I also was able to sit down this week, look through all the materials you enabled me to purchase, and planned out the rest of the year!!! Each week with its own theme, books, songs, art activities, and even BOOM cards. In a school year that many of us have been holding our breath, I can exhale and know that I am equipped and able to move forward through these challenges. I can use the precious time I have left each week to focus on the student's and families individual needs. The preschoolers are even having fun too! Words can never truly express how thankful I am.
